Brett Trapp of the online memoir/story/audio story Blue Babies Pink is a writer, speaker and marketing consultant whose story took my heart by storm this past spring. Brett's "Southern coming out story" has been described as the "Netflix of blogs" - and is the epitome of Brené Brown's "excruciating vulnerability." He risked a lot to tell his true story. And it's awesome.
So I was thrilled to get him on the show to talk about what it really means to tell his own true story with so much grace - and to embrace not only the need for us as speakers and leaders to speak with vulnerability, but the power of that embracing as well.
